The Double Diamond Ruler provides a marvelous way for you to add a diamond-shaped embellishment to any project. Prior to the invention of the Double Diamond Ruler it was quite cumbersome to produce a diamond pattern. In the past you would have had to make a pattern onto fusible interfacing, press it onto the fabric and then snip the lines you drew with a pair of scissors. Talk about time consuming! The Double Diamond Ruler ended all that.

The Double Diamond Ruler is available in two sizes which makes it possible for you to make either 1 1/2″ or 3 1/2″ wide diamonds. Use the 1 1/2″ Double Diamond Ruler to create an eye-catching eyeglass case or purse strap. Add distinctive, dimensional diamonds to a wall hanging, table runner or even table topper using the 3 1/2″ Double Diamond Ruler.

Once you have decided which sized Double Diamond Ruler will work best for your project you’ll want to pick out 3 quality fabrics to work with: a background fabric, main fabric and contrast fabric. Solid color cloths work best but the diamonds do not display well when you use large prints. Nonetheless, small prints can produce an intersting effect.
